Output 402329130d2f8435b74ec9dcf0dceef5e66b4f865a2ed3e0105cbcd9f7bcbb9f:0

value
185841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c289f84a782e42319d1c54dae23850fdfb5bc53 OP_EQUAL
address
3D1WNsfsLCTYD9Ubm4xg6z2cPYmg5WH5Uc
transaction
402329130d2f8435b74ec9dcf0dceef5e66b4f865a2ed3e0105cbcd9f7bcbb9f
confirmations
2527
spent
true